Title | New Book: Educating English Language Learners |
Body | From http://www.cambridge.org/us/catalogue/catalogue.asp?isbn=0521676991 Educating English Language Learners: A Synthesis of Research Evidence Fred Genesee, McGill University, Montréal Kathryn Lindholm-Leary, San José State University, California Bill Saunders, California State University, Long Beach Donna Christian, Centre for Applied Linguistics, Washington D.C. Research on students in kindergarten to grade 12 is analyzed to provide this review of scientific research on the learning outcomes of students with limited or no proficiency in English in U.S. schools. The primary chapters of the book focus on these students' acquisition of oral language skills in English, their development of literacy (reading & writing) skills in English, instructional issues in teaching literacy, and achievement in academic domains (i.e., mathematics, science, and reading). The book provides a unique set of summary tables that supply details about each study.
